Chapter 5

 

 

V1-2 We have already determined what walking in love pertains to i.e. following Torah in Spirit and in truth. Yeshua willingly gave Himself up for us. Although it was the Father’s will to appropriate grace to the forsaken world through sacrifice of His Son, ultimately Yeshua had the freewill to fulfil this end, and wrestled much with this decision in the garden of Gethsemane cf Lk 22:42-44. He was our Passover lamb, unblemished and without sin, being a sweet-smelling savour to Elohim.

 

V3-6 This is purely so-called Old Testament rhetoric. Paul, a law-abiding Christian, no longer a pharisaic judaizer, still preached Torah observance. Porneia/fornication covers all manner of illicit sexual conduct i.e. adultery, homosexuality, lesbianism, bestiality, incest, sex during menstruation, sex out of wedlock, all of which are laid out in the Torah in Leviticus. Akatharsia/Uncleanness included non-Kosher food, leprosy, sexual discharges amongst others again all laid out in Torah.

 

Covetousness is mentioned in the 10 commandments. Pornos/whoremonger is one who partakes in illicit sex, more specifically male prostitution. Eidolatres/idolater is one who participates in the worship of the heathen, including attending their sacrificial feasts. V26-27 It is not only the blood of Yeshua that is essential for sanctification, but also the water of the word of Elohim cf Ex 30:18-20. The laver of brass was made out of the looking glasses of the women Ex 38:8. Hence before a priest in the tabernacle washed himself, he would see the dirt on him in the brass laver providing his reflection. This dirt represents sin. We cannot approach Elohim in a sinful state lest we die. Hence the need to examine ourselves by His word in order to be cleansed by its waters of refreshing cf Jn 15:3; Tit 3:5-7; Heb 10:22; 1 Jn 5-6.
